well, to lose, you usually take your lbm and times that by 10 or 12, and thats how many cals per day ya need. To gain..eh usuallllly like 14 on up or so. Protein should rpetty much universally be kept at at least 1 gram per lb of lbm per day. And the basic lean out diet is to eat at 33%33%33% macronutrients divided between however many meals , usually 5 on average.
